Input Shaft Oil Seal Replacement
CAUTION:
Contamination and rough handling of the transaxle may cause premature wear, functional problems and damage to parts.
NOTE:
- Thoroughly clean the exterior of the transaxle before disassembling it.
- Keep workbench, tools and hands clean during the service operation.
- Use special care when handling aluminum parts so as not to damage them.
- Keep removed parts free of dust and other foreign matter.
- Dismount CVT assembly, see CVT Assembly Dismounting and Remounting .
- Remove torque converter (1) from CVT assembly.
- Remove input shaft oil seal (1) by using flat-end screwdriver or the like (2).CAUTION: When removing oil seal, be careful not to scratch the oil seal press-fit part of transaxle housing. Otherwise CVT fluid may cause leakage.
- Apply grease to new input shaft oil seal lip.
: Grease 99000-25030 (SUZUKI Super Grease C)
- Using special tool, install input shaft oil seal (1) at specified position as shown in figure.
Special Tool
- 09914-87910
- 09922-59420
Input shaft oil seal installing depth
"a": 0.5 - 1.5 mm (0.020 - 0.059 in.)
- Install torque converter (3) noting the following points.CAUTION: Failure to take proper precautions before and during installation of the torque converter can cause damage to other parts.
- Before installing torque converter, make sure that its pump hub portion is free from nicks, burrs or damage which may cause oil seal to leak.
- Be very careful not to drop torque converter on oil pump. Damage in gear, should it occur, may cause a critical trouble.
- Install torque converter aligning projection (1) of torque converter and grooves (2) of oil pump.
- Install torque converter, using care not to damage input shaft oil seal.
- After installing torque converter (3), check that distance "a" is within specification.
Torque converter installing position
"a": More than 17.0 mm (0.669 in.)
- Check torque converter for smooth rotation.
- Remount CVT assembly, see CVT Assembly Dismounting and Remounting .
- Refill CVT fluid, see CVT Fluid Change
- Check CVT fluid level, see CVT FLUID CHECK .
- After installation, check for CVT fluid leakage at each connection.
